ARM: dts: qcom: sdx55: Move reset and wake gpios to board dts
authorManivannan Sadhasivam <manivannan.sadhasivam@linaro.org>
Fri, 31 Mar 2023 14:59:14 +0000 (20:29 +0530)
committerBjorn Andersson <andersson@kernel.org>
Fri, 7 Apr 2023 23:30:47 +0000 (16:30 -0700)
The reset and wake properties in the PCIe EP node belong to the board dts
as they can be customized per board design. So let's move them from SoC
dtsi.

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org>
Reviewed-by: Konrad Dybcio <konrad.dybcio@linaro.org>
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
Link: https://lore.kernel.org/r/20230331145915.11653-1-manivannan.sadhasivam@linaro.org
arch/arm/boot/dts/qcom-sdx55-telit-fn980-tlb.dts
arch/arm/boot/dts/qcom-sdx55.dtsi

index 81f33eb..b73b707 100644 (file)
        pinctrl-names = "default";
        pinctrl-0 = <&pcie_ep_clkreq_default &pcie_ep_perst_default
                     &pcie_ep_wake_default>;
+
+       reset-gpios = <&tlmm 57 GPIO_ACTIVE_LOW>;
+       wake-gpios = <&tlmm 53 GPIO_ACTIVE_LOW>;
 };
 
 &qpic_bam {
index 9148a84..342c3d1 100644 (file)
                                     <GIC_SPI 145 IRQ_TYPE_LEVEL_HIGH>;
                        interrupt-names = "global",
                                          "doorbell";
-                       reset-gpios = <&tlmm 57 GPIO_ACTIVE_LOW>;
-                       wake-gpios = <&tlmm 53 GPIO_ACTIVE_LOW>;
                        resets = <&gcc GCC_PCIE_BCR>;
                        reset-names = "core";
                        power-domains = <&gcc PCIE_GDSC>;